The global Controlled Atmosphere Room Ventilation Market is witnessing robust growth as industries seek to enhance storage conditions, prolong shelf life, and improve product quality. Controlled atmosphere (CA) ventilation systems regulate temperature, humidity, and gas composition, ensuring optimal conditions in warehouses, cold storage, and industrial storage facilities.
CA room ventilation is critical for maintaining product integrity, particularly for perishable goods such as fruits, vegetables, pharmaceuticals, and other sensitive materials. By controlling oxygen, carbon dioxide, and humidity levels, these systems help minimize spoilage, microbial growth, and quality degradation.

One of the primary drivers of this market is the growing need to reduce post-harvest losses in the agriculture and food sectors. CA ventilation extends the storage life of perishable goods, supporting global food security initiatives and reducing economic losses.
Another growth driver is the rise in pharmaceutical and biotechnological production. Sensitive compounds and vaccines require precise environmental control to maintain efficacy, making CA ventilation essential in storage and laboratory environments.
Technological advancements further support market growth. Automated monitoring, IoT-enabled ventilation systems, and predictive analytics allow operators to maintain optimal conditions while reducing energy consumption and operational costs.

Despite strong growth prospects, the Controlled Atmosphere Room Ventilation Market faces certain restraints. High installation costs and ongoing maintenance expenses may deter small and mid-sized businesses from adopting advanced CA ventilation solutions.
Complexity in system design and operation can also be challenging. Maintaining precise atmospheric conditions requires skilled personnel and sophisticated monitoring tools, which may not be accessible in all regions.
Additionally, inconsistent standards and regulations across countries can complicate adoption. Businesses operating in multiple regions must navigate varying compliance requirements, increasing operational complexity.
